Q: Is 230,163 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 230,163 is not a prime number.

Why is 230,163 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 230163 can be evenly divided by 1 3 17 51 4,513 13,539 76,721 and 230,163, with no remainder.

Since 230,163 cannot be divided by just 1 and 230,163, it is not a prime number.
